Skip to content

Commit

Permalink
Merge branch 'master' into master
Browse files Browse the repository at this point in the history
  • Loading branch information
dwasint authored Oct 23, 2023
2 parents 576cd05 + 52cf482 commit d181c6b
Show file tree
Hide file tree
Showing 2,705 changed files with 267,577 additions and 67,186 deletions.
2 changes: 1 addition & 1 deletion .github/guides/AUTODOC.md
Original file line number Diff line number Diff line change
Expand Up @@ -87,7 +87,7 @@ where you don't want to be tied to the formal layout of the class structure.
On /tg/station we do this by adding markdown files inside the `code` directory
that will also be rendered and added to the modules tree. The structure for
these is deliberately not defined, so you can be as freeform and as wheeling as
you would like.
you would like.

[Here is a representative example of what you might write](http://codedocs.tgstation13.org/code/modules/keybindings/readme.html)

Expand Down
35 changes: 35 additions & 0 deletions .github/workflows/ci_suite.yml
Original file line number Diff line number Diff line change
Expand Up @@ -169,6 +169,41 @@ jobs:
steps:
- run: echo Alternate tests passed.

compare_screenshots:
if: "!contains(github.event.head_commit.message, '[ci skip]') && (success() || failure())"
needs: [run_all_tests, run_alternate_tests]
name: Compare Screenshot Tests
runs-on: ubuntu-20.04
steps:
- uses: actions/checkout@v3
# If we ever add more artifacts, this is going to break, but it'll be obvious.
- name: Download screenshot tests
uses: actions/download-artifact@v3
with:
path: artifacts
- name: ls -R
run: ls -R artifacts
- name: Setup screenshot comparison
run: npm i
working-directory: tools/screenshot-test-comparison
- name: Run screenshot comparison
run: node tools/screenshot-test-comparison/index.js artifacts code/modules/unit_tests/screenshots artifacts/screenshot_comparisons
# workflow_run does not give you the PR it ran on,
# even through the thing literally named "matching pull requests".
# However, in GraphQL, you can check if the check suite was ran
# by a specific PR, so trusting the (user controlled) action here is okay,
# as long as we check it later in show_screenshot_test_results
- name: Save PR ID
if: failure() && github.event.pull_request
run: |
echo ${{ github.event.pull_request.number }} > artifacts/screenshot_comparisons/pull_request_number.txt
- name: Upload bad screenshots
if: failure()
uses: actions/upload-artifact@v3
with:
name: bad-screenshots
path: artifacts/screenshot_comparisons

test_windows:
if: "!contains(github.event.head_commit.message, '[ci skip]')"
name: Windows Build
Expand Down
42 changes: 0 additions & 42 deletions .github/workflows/gbp.yml

This file was deleted.

44 changes: 0 additions & 44 deletions .github/workflows/gbp_collect.yml

This file was deleted.

3 changes: 3 additions &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-233,3 +233,6 @@ Tracy.exe

# From /tools/define_sanity/check.py - potential output file that we load onto the user's machine that we don't want to have committed.
define_sanity_output.txt

#This file contains developer-specific config overrides. These shouldn't be committed.
config/_config_nogit.txt
2 changes: 1 addition & 1 deletion _maps/RandomRuins/AnywhereRuins/fountain_hall.dmm
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
/turf/open/floor/engine/cult,
/area/ruin/unpowered)
"g" = (
/mob/living/simple_animal/butterfly,
/mob/living/basic/butterfly,
/turf/open/floor/engine/cult,
/area/ruin/unpowered)
"h" = (
Expand Down
8 changes: 4 additions & 4 deletions _maps/RandomRuins/IceRuins/icemoon_surface_bughabitat.dmm
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@
/turf/open/floor/plastic,
/area/ruin/bughabitat)
"cK" = (
/mob/living/simple_animal/hostile/ant{
/mob/living/basic/ant{
environment_smash = 0
},
/turf/open/floor/grass,
Expand Down Expand Up @@ -178,7 +178,7 @@
/turf/open/floor/plastic,
/area/ruin/bughabitat)
"uB" = (
/mob/living/simple_animal/butterfly,
/mob/living/basic/butterfly,
/obj/structure/chair/pew/left{
dir = 8
},
Expand All @@ -205,7 +205,7 @@
/turf/open/floor/plastic,
/area/ruin/bughabitat)
"xq" = (
/mob/living/simple_animal/butterfly,
/mob/living/basic/butterfly,
/obj/effect/turf_decal/siding/wideplating/light{
color = "#236F26"
},
Expand Down Expand Up @@ -322,7 +322,7 @@
/obj/item/stack/ducts/fifty{
amount = 23
},
/mob/living/simple_animal/butterfly,
/mob/living/basic/butterfly,
/turf/open/floor/plastic,
/area/ruin/bughabitat)
"Nv" = (
Expand Down
2 changes: 1 addition & 1 deletion _maps/RandomRuins/IceRuins/icemoon_surface_lust.dmm
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@
"e" = (
/obj/item/greentext{
light_color = "#64C864";
light_range = 1
light_outer_range = 1
},
/turf/open/floor/mineral/diamond,
/area/icemoon/surface/outdoors)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-1325,7 +1325,7 @@
/area/ruin/plasma_facility/operations)
"vz" = (
/obj/effect/decal/cleanable/dirt,
/obj/machinery/light/floor,
/obj/machinery/light/floor/has_bulb,
/turf/open/floor/plating/snowed/icemoon,
/area/icemoon/underground/explored)
"vI" = (
Expand Down
7 changes: 4 additions & 3 deletions _maps/RandomRuins/IceRuins/icemoon_underground_library.dmm
Original file line number Diff line number Diff line change
Expand Up @@ -178,7 +178,7 @@
},
/area/ruin/unpowered/buried_library)
"aO" = (
/mob/living/simple_animal/pet/fox,
/mob/living/basic/pet/fox,
/turf/open/floor/wood{
initial_gas_mix = "ICEMOON_ATMOS"
},
Expand Down Expand Up @@ -298,7 +298,7 @@
/area/ruin/unpowered/buried_library)
"bh" = (
/obj/effect/decal/cleanable/dirt/dust,
/mob/living/simple_animal/pet/fox,
/mob/living/basic/pet/fox,
/turf/open/floor/wood{
initial_gas_mix = "ICEMOON_ATMOS"
},
Expand Down Expand Up @@ -384,7 +384,8 @@
/obj/structure/fluff/paper{
dir = 1
},
/mob/living/simple_animal/pet/fox,
/obj/effect/decal/cleanable/dirt,
/mob/living/basic/pet/fox,
/turf/open/floor/wood{
initial_gas_mix = "ICEMOON_ATMOS"
},
Expand Down
8 changes: 4 additions & 4 deletions _maps/RandomRuins/LavaRuins/lavaland_biodome_beach.dmm
Original file line number Diff line number Diff line change
Expand Up @@ -224,7 +224,7 @@
/turf/open/floor/wood,
/area/ruin/powered/beach)
"fS" = (
/mob/living/simple_animal/crab{
/mob/living/basic/crab{
name = "Jonny"
},
/turf/open/misc/beach/sand,
Expand Down Expand Up @@ -560,7 +560,7 @@
/turf/closed/wall/mineral/wood/nonmetal,
/area/ruin/powered/beach)
"sA" = (
/mob/living/simple_animal/crab{
/mob/living/basic/crab{
name = "Jon"
},
/turf/open/misc/beach/sand,
Expand Down Expand Up @@ -761,7 +761,7 @@
/area/ruin/powered/beach)
"AB" = (
/obj/effect/turf_decal/sand,
/mob/living/simple_animal/crab{
/mob/living/basic/crab{
name = "James"
},
/turf/open/misc/beach/sand,
Expand Down Expand Up @@ -1270,7 +1270,7 @@
/area/ruin/powered/beach)
"SC" = (
/obj/machinery/light/directional/north,
/mob/living/simple_animal/crab{
/mob/living/basic/crab{
name = "Eddie"
},
/turf/open/misc/beach/sand,
Expand Down
14 changes: 4 additions & 10 deletions _maps/RandomRuins/LavaRuins/lavaland_surface_gaia.dmm
Original file line number Diff line number Diff line change
Expand Up @@ -36,9 +36,7 @@
/turf/open/misc/grass/lavaland,
/area/ruin/unpowered/gaia)
"j" = (
/mob/living/simple_animal/butterfly{
atmos_requirements = list()
},
/mob/living/basic/butterfly/lavaland,
/turf/open/misc/grass/lavaland,
/area/ruin/unpowered/gaia)
"l" = (
Expand All @@ -54,8 +52,7 @@
/turf/open/misc/grass/lavaland,
/area/ruin/unpowered/gaia)
"p" = (
/mob/living/simple_animal/hostile/lightgeist{
AIStatus = 1;
/mob/living/basic/lightgeist{
light_color = "#42ECFF"
},
/turf/open/misc/grass/lavaland,
Expand All @@ -67,9 +64,7 @@
"r" = (
/obj/structure/flora/grass/jungle/b/style_random,
/obj/structure/flora/bush/sparsegrass/style_random,
/mob/living/simple_animal/butterfly{
atmos_requirements = list()
},
/mob/living/basic/butterfly/lavaland,
/turf/open/misc/grass/lavaland,
/area/ruin/unpowered/gaia)
"s" = (
Expand All @@ -93,8 +88,7 @@
/area/ruin/unpowered/gaia)
"B" = (
/obj/structure/flora/grass/jungle/a/style_random,
/mob/living/simple_animal/hostile/lightgeist{
AIStatus = 1;
/mob/living/basic/lightgeist{
light_color = "#42ECFF"
},
/turf/open/misc/grass/lavaland,
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-496,7 +496,7 @@
/turf/open/floor/carpet/blue/lavaland,
/area/ruin/unpowered)
"Fg" = (
/mob/living/simple_animal/hostile/asteroid/goliath/beast,
/mob/living/basic/mining/goliath,
/obj/effect/decal/cleanable/blood/old,
/turf/open/misc/asteroid/basalt/lava_land_surface,
/area/lavaland/surface/outdoors)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-375,8 +375,8 @@
dir = 8
},
/obj/structure/table/reinforced,
/obj/machinery/splicer,
/obj/item/food/grown/poppy/lily,
/obj/machinery/plantgenes,
/turf/open/floor/mineral/plastitanium,
/area/ruin/powered/seedvault)
"bb" = (
Expand Down
Loading

0 comments on commit d181c6b

Please sign in to comment.